    Ken Haines. Ken Haines (born September 5, 1942) is an American television sports broadcasting executive who is known for negotiating television media and marketing contracts with universities, conferences and major broadcasting networks and cable companies. He is a retired president and CEO from Raycom Sports .

The ACC on Regional Sports Networks (also known as simply ACC RSN) was a package of telecasts produced by Raycom Sports, in cooperation with Bally Sports, previously the Fox Sports Networks, featuring Atlantic Coast Conference (ACC) college sports. The package was syndicated primarily to regional sports networks .
